Sirius Satellite Capability On non-Premium Radio
As one who is addicted to Sirius satellite radio, I just wanted to inform the forum that all Escape Hybrids with either the standard (no extra option cost) or "Premium Audiophile" radio option (a $595.00 option) built after October 6th, 2005 now have a Sirius compatible radio in them (as well as being able to play MP3 CD's).
THE NAVIGATION RADIO DOES NOT HAVE SIRIUS CAPABILITY EVEN ON THOSE BUILT AFTER OCTOBER 6TH. There was a post to this forum awhile back claiming that the navigation radio was indeed Sirius compatible. However, this is not the case. First, there's only one connection on the radio for a "jukebox" cable. This is already used by the 6 CD changer and is therefore unavailable for the Visteon Sirius box. Also, on Ford/Visteon radios with GPS capability (the Lincoln LS for example), the Sirius satellite software functionality must be configured in software using a data CD provided by Ford to the dealership. No such data CD exists which allows compatibility with the Sirius box on the Escape navigation radio.
If you're looking at the sticker for an Escape Hybrid on the dealer's web site, you can tell whether the standard no-cost radio installed in the particular Escape Hybrid has Sirius capability if the sticker says "Job 2" on it.
Previously, only Escape Hybrids with the $600.00 option "Audiophile Premium Sound System" were available with a Sirius and MP3 compatible radio.
Sirius Visteon adapter units which plug into the "Job 2" Escape Hybrid radio are available as a "dealer option" and come with a 6 month free subscription to Sirius.
